CVE-2018-16509 is a high-severity vulnerability affecting Artifex Ghostscript versions prior to 9.24, as well as products from Canonical, Debian, and Red Hat. It stems from improper privilege restoration during /invalidaccess exception handling, allowing attackers to execute arbitrary code via crafted PostScript using the "pipe" instruction. With a CVSS score of 7.8, this vulnerability has a high imp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ability, requiring user interaction but with low attack complexity. While not on the KEV catalog, a Metasploit module exists for exploitation, indicating readily available exploit code, though there is no evidence of active exploitation or significant community discussion.
